Apparently NBC doesn’t think he is so great. After putting out what I can only assume is a lot of money to produce 4 episodes, NBC pulled the plug without even airing one.

Gawker.com has it all:

NBC announced last Friday that it had canceled its mid season Dane Cook vehicle Next Caller before airing a single episode.

The show would have revolved around an egotistical, misogynistic radio DJ (Cook) “forced to share the microphone for a relationship call-in show” with a “perky feminist” (Collette Wolfe) who previously worked at NPR.

According to Deadline, which first reported the news, the network was unhappy with the show’s “creative direction.”
